Fighting for Intelligent, Rational, and Ethical Dismissal Act

H.R. 2446 · 115th Congress · May 16, 2017 · Lineage

A BILL

To amend the Omnibus Crime Control and Safe Streets Act of 1968 to provide that the Director of the Federal Bureau of Investigation may only be removed for cause, and for other purposes.

Section 1 Short title

This Act may be cited as the “Fighting for Intelligent, Rational, and Ethical Dismissal Act” or the “FIRED Act”.

Sec. 2 Removal of the Director of the Federal Bureau of Investigation

(a)
Removal for cause— Section 1101(b) of title VI of the Omnibus Crime Control and Safe Streets Act of 1968 (Public Law 90–351) is amended by adding at the end the following new sentence: “The President may remove the Director for inefficiency, neglect of duty, or malfeasance in office.”.
(b)
Application— The amendment made by subsection (a) shall apply to any Director of the Federal Bureau of Investigation appointed on or after the date of enactment of this Act.
